Pharoah Sanders - Live At Fabrik Hamburg 1980
2023 Jazzline pressed by Vinyl Plant, Estonia (not confirmed)

Wonderful live recording from the archives of the NDR (Biggest Radio Station in Northern Germany). Concert took place at the legendary Fabrik in Hamburg-Altona. Record is part of a Fabrik series (also some with Gil Evans, McCoy Tyner, Freddie Hubbard etc.).

I read somewhere that it is pressed in Estonia, but it is not mentioned somewhere at the record. Pressing is real good, can be compared with a good one from Optimal. Sanders shows his virtuosity in a great Quartet with John Hicks p, Curtis Lundy b and Idris Muhammad d. They play so well together and you always have the feeling that they had loads of fun. SQ is fantastic, the soundstage is not as wide open as it is in the Jaco album but a 2LP set for 22 EUR in such a quality is called a bargain :ok_hand:

The first solo album - New Blue Sun- from Andre 3000 from OutKast. Surprisingly it’s not rap but ……ambient jazz with no vocals! Contains some 12 minute long jazz flute jams and a hefty debt to Alice Coltrane. Surprisingly good

Orb- Prism - 2023

Must be one of their more accessible albums? A great mix of dub, ambient electronica and a light dusting of drum&bass. It’s had a good few plays this year.
